    Enhancing open world / immersion / lore

    You have many players complaining about how small the world is and how it's an "empty lobby" and I have an idea that could change this with minimal cost for new assets.

    I believe you can make a lot of people happy as well as improve the games immersion and depth if once you clear a dungeon, you're able to enter it in an open world setting with no or very few monsters. You can turn them into mini quest hubs so a player can see what happens after they clear it.

    As it stands now, you are tasked with clearing a dungeon for an NPC - but for what? I cleared Stone Vigil for Ishgard and it just fills back up with dragons and it remains a dragon stronghold? Why not see them having taken it back with quests to help restore it? Why not see Sibold paying respects at Chimera's den with a quest to learn more about the Darklight Raiders? Why can't we enter Dzemael Darkhold and see it completed?

    I believe there are many things that can be done with this, please look into it.

    Quote Originally Posted by AmyNeudaiz View Post
    But it would be leaps and bounds less than all new content as they already have the assets done and ready, as in the area being added is already competed and just needs to be put in.
    From the little bit of game design I've done, here is where the problem lies. Just because you have a space fleshed out and set up in a separate location does not mean it can be tacked on to the existing world. Doing this is essentially like creating new content; not new art concepts and all that but changing the geometry of the established map to fit this entire new "zone" into your current space.

    I do think this could be done in patches maybe, like the structure shifting they did in patch 2.1, but then we would see a delay in actual new content for patches because they would be working on fitting in dungeons for us to just walk around in. I hope I'm not coming across as "hating" on your idea. I just don't think it would be feasible to do now, while they are trying to create content for us in their alternating patch schedule currently running. Maybe if we ever see some downtime in the development cycle?
